What Is a Gimbal and Why You Need One?

A gimbal is a device that uses motors and sensors to stabilize the camera while shooting video. It allows you to capture smooth, cinematic footage, even when you’re on the move. This is particularly valuable in situations like outdoor shoots, travel vlogs, or even just casual family gatherings. Imagine filming your child’s birthday party or a vacation trip without the shaky instability that often comes with handheld shooting—this is where a gimbal comes into play.

How to Choose the Right Hohem Gimbal?

Choosing the right gimbal largely depends on your shooting style, the subjects you plan to film, and your budget. Here are some key factors to consider:

1. Weight Capacity

Ensure the gimbal can support your smartphone’s weight. Most modern smartphones fit within the capacity of Hohem gimbals, but it’s always smart to double-check.

2. Battery Life

Long-lasting battery life is essential for extended shooting sessions. Look for models that offer at least 10-12 hours of continuous use to avoid interruptions during critical moments.

3. Features and Modes

Different gimbals offer various features such as time-lapse, object tracking, or panorama modes. Determine which features align with your filmmaking needs before making a purchase.

4. Portability

If you plan to carry your gimbal during travel, weight and foldability become crucial aspects. Opt for lighter models that can fit in your bag easily.

Tips for Using a Hohem Gimbal Effectively

Once you’ve made your choice and purchased a Hohem gimbal, understanding how to use it effectively can further enhance your videography experience. Here are some tips:

1. Balance the Gimbal

Before you turn on the gimbal, make sure it's correctly balanced. This ensures smooth operations and extends the life of the motors.

2. Learn the Controls

Familiarize yourself with the buttons and functions of your gimbal. Understanding how to switch modes, adjust settings, and use the features can help you maximize your shooting potential.

3. Practice

The best way to learn how to use a gimbal is through practice. Film various scenarios to see how the settings change and how the gimbal adds stability to your shots.
